Dexter Drumlin in Lancaster MA, a Trustees property, offers picturesque, quintessential New England scenes. Open to the public you can climb the hill and see a beautiful pastoral view of Lancaster MA farmland. I’m often drawn here when the skies are full of clouds and the weather is about to change. This shot is the frontside of the hill covered with queen anne’s lace on a summer day.
